The shoots are beginer friendly! I would suggest coming with a little practice under your belt before expecting a high placing, but a bunch of fun if you enjoy hunting, shooting or steel. These shoots go from as close as 150 yards on the small game targets to as far as 1000 plus sometimes on the big game targets.

If you wanted to practice and see what it is like you could check out the small game shoots and see what you think. They are cheaper and not real intense on the competition side. Take a look at the website for rules and dates and come out, bring a couple friends or your kids and have a good time.
